Traboules are a type of covered passageway Lyon is known for. Traboules du Vieux Lyon were built mainly as footpaths for silk merchants in the 14th century to transport their goods. However, some believe that they appeared as early as the 4th century to transport water from the Saone river to people's homes. During World War II, Traboules du Vieux Lyon provided cover for local resistance fighters against German invasion. About 40 traboules are open to the public; others are only for private use. Keep your eyes peeled inside the snake-like passageways. You may spot secret exits, hidden spiral staircases, and shortcuts that lead to an off-the-beaten path cafe. Discovering the Hidden Passages of Les Traboules du Vieux Lyon: A Promising but Underwhelming Experience While the experience had some exciting elements, overall, I must rate it 3 stars out of 5. Les Traboules du Vieux Lyon is a network of hidden passageways that connect buildings in the historic district of Lyon. As someone who enjoys exploring hidden gems in new cities, I was intrigued to see what Les Traboules had to offer. The passageways themselves were fascinating, and I enjoyed the feeling of discovering something off the beaten path. However, the overall experience was underwhelming. One recurring issue I noticed was the lack of signage and direction. It was challenging to navigate the passages without a map or guide, and even with one, some passages were closed off without explanation. Additionally, the passageways were dimly lit and often cramped, which made for an uncomfortable experience. On the positive side, the passageways themselves were historical and provided a glimpse into Lyon's past. However, the lack of additional information or context made it difficult to fully appreciate the significance of what we were seeing. If Les Traboules du Vieux Lyon were to improve, I would suggest investing in more signage and informative displays to help visitors navigate the passages and understand their historical significance. Additionally, more attention to the lighting and overall ambiance of the passageways could make for a more enjoyable experience. In conclusion, while Les Traboules du Vieux Lyon was a promising concept, the execution left something to be desired. For those interested in history or off-the-beaten-path experiences, it may still be worth a visit, but be prepared for some confusion and discomfort along the way. I would recommend it to others with a caveat, but personally, I'm unlikely to visit again anytime soon.
